try to have a lower view point ( camera about 1ft from ground ).
use bigger aperture setting to blur the background more.
I should say that about 10mins after the sun rise above the horizon, the lights are very directional ( this is when you should be taking just shot ). after that, the intensity will be stronger and more diffused.
